Job description

Job Description

Join our passionate team at Dr. Tavel, a family-owned business with a rich history of over 80 years in serving Hoosier's eyecare needs. In the last decade, we've seen exponential growth in revenue and headcount, and we're looking for an experienced HR and Talent Acquisition Manager to be a key player in our continued success. In this role, you'll have the unique opportunity to shape the future of our workforce and contribute significantly to our dynamic environment.

Responsibilities:

Talent Acquisition and Recruitment:

  • Develop and execute effective recruiting strategies, managing one internal recruiter and collaborating with external agencies.
  • Oversee the recruitment process from job posting to hiring, ensuring alignment with our company goals.
  • Work closely with hiring managers to create impactful job descriptions and streamline the talent acquisition process, while respecting the final hiring decisions made by business leaders.
  • Create a robust talent pipeline by building relationships with schools, employment organizations, and attending career fairs

Employee Relations:

  • Serve as the go-to expert on HR compliance, providing support and advice to department heads, who retain final decision-making authority.
  • Develop and enforce HR policies to ensure legal compliance and alignment with industry standards.
  • Act as a trusted advisor on employee relations, conducting investigations and offering guidance on complex issues.

Performance Management:

  • Implement performance appraisal systems to evaluate and enhance employee performance.
  • Assist in developing career growth plans, offering coaching and counseling on performance-related matters.

Training and Development:

  • Lead initiatives in leadership development and succession planning.
  • Be the Predictive Index expert on our team, leveraging this tool to maximize employee potential.
  • Continuously improve our new hire orientation and onboarding processes.
  • Mentor employees in the organization as they grow in their career with us.

Compliance and Legal:

  • Stay abreast of labor laws and ensure company-wide compliance.
  • Manage HR documentation and records with utmost diligence and accuracy.

Requirements

  • At least 5 years of HR and recruiting experience.
  • Bachelor’s degree (SHRM certification is a plus).
  • Proficiency in HRIS systems (experience with Paycor is advantageous).
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to quickly adapt to new challenges.
  • A track record of ownership in the successes or areas of improvement within an HR department.
  • Comfortable with training in both group and one-on-one settings.
  • Skilled in building trust and rapport across all levels of the organization.
